Frappe is a highly loved beverage among coffee lovers, sweet and with a creamy texture, accidentally discovered by the Greeks in 1957.
The multitude of recipes we find clearly shows that the frappe is more of a drink that adapts depending on the consumer.
Frappes are found in many contexts as a coffee-based drink, although there are many variations that don't contain coffee at all.
This is due more to the fact that this drink is not generally consumed by the biggest coffee enthusiasts, but rather by fans of creamy textures, whipped cream, and sweet syrups.
How to make a frappe?
You can always be creative in making a frappe by combining an infinite number of coffee variations with milk and syrups.
To get a good, sweet, and creamy frappe at home, you need one of the following tools.
Shaker
Blender
Jar with a lid
Frappe machine

With any of the above options, you can get a delicious frappe, so choose the container that's convenient for you and add the following ingredients.
1 teaspoon of instant coffee or 5-6 cubes of ice cubes from your favorite coffee or
a double cold espresso.
200 ml milk or 200 ml half & half
25 ml of sugar syrup
All ingredients are vigorously homogenized until a dense cream forms and are poured into a glass and served with either whipped cream, your favorite syrup, or both.
Frappe preparation Tips & Tricks
Espresso dilutes the milk cream, so it can be replaced with a scoop of vanilla ice cream for a thicker texture and a sweeter taste.
Always use cold espresso for best results.
Use half & half for the densest cream.
Get ice cubes from cold brew for a less accentuated coffee taste
